Q: Is 16,920,356 a Prime Number?
A: No, 16,920,356 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 16920356 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 53 106 212 79,813 159,626 319,252 4,230,089 8,460,178 and 16,920,356, with no remainder.
Since 16,920,356 cannot be divided by just 1 and 16,920,356, it is not a prime number.
